Transaction eeb645e969b34a2a361c91138c8f91673f78127570285e6f47cab21c70860124

1 Input
2 Outputs
  • eeb645e969b34a2a361c91138c8f91673f78127570285e6f47cab21c70860124:0
  • value  78600
    address  16WfpL5c1Xh47XwypA3uonq46BP7vnrxT9
  • eeb645e969b34a2a361c91138c8f91673f78127570285e6f47cab21c70860124:1
  • value  7002744
    address  3Bj2jVXAdkdCiPgnGuqxjhQEdZAVDo3hdf